this will scan the specified directory every minute for created/removed dirs, report those to you and log to bot's main logfile
Code:

set you yournick
set dir /home/you/www
bind time - * foo
proc foo {m h d mo y} {
   global bar dir you
   if ![info exists bar] {
      set bar [glob -dir $dir -types d -tails *]
   } else {
      set moo [glob -dir $dir -types d -tails *]
      foreach d $moo {
         if {[lsearch -exact $bar $d] == -1} {
            putserv "privmsg $you :created $d"
            putlog "created directory $d"
         }
      }
      foreach d $bar {
         if {[lsearch -exact $moo $d] == -1} {
            putserv "privmsg $you :removed $d"
            putlog "removed directory $d"
         }
      }
      set bar $moo
   }
}
